The ASC RING16G110 is a durable, galvanized 16-gauge C-ring designed for strong, reliable fastening in cage building, fencing, packaging, upholstery, and general wire-mesh or metal-frame applications. Its balanced gauge and corrosion-resistant finish make it suitable for both indoor and outdoor use.
Key Features & Specifications
-
Wire Gauge: 16-gauge steel for dependable strength and secure crimping
-
Ring Style: C-ring (hog-ring style) designed to crimp tightly onto mesh, wire, or tubular frames
-
Open Ring Size: 3/4" opening accommodates thick mesh, bundles, or tubing prior to closure
-
Closed Ring Size: 3/16" to 11/32"
-
Finish: Galvanized coating for improved corrosion resistance
-
Point Style: Standard blunt-style legs for smooth, controlled closure
-
Packaging: Bulk-pack quantity ideal for professional or high-volume applications
-
Quantity: 11,000 rings per case
-
Tool Compatibility: Works with 16-gauge C-ring or hog-ring pliers, including both manual and pneumatic tools such as Bostitch SC742, SC743
Why This C-Ring Matters
This 16-gauge C-ring provides the ideal mix of strength, versatility, and durability. It crimp-locks securely around wire, mesh, or frame components, making it an efficient alternative to screws, welding, or complex fasteners. The galvanized finish enhances long-term performance in outdoor, agricultural, or high-moisture environments. Its ¾" open diameter gives you flexibility in working with larger mesh sizes, multiple wires, or metal tubing.
